Summary
This study evaluated alphavirus-replicon RNA vaccines against lethal Crimean-Congo hemorrhagic fever virus challenge in mice. Nucleoprotein RNA alone prevented clinical disease, while combining nucleoprotein and glycoprotein precursor RNA strongly limited both disease and viral replication after as little as one 100-nanogram immunization, eliciting an unexpected mix of antibody and cellular responses.
